原文:Codeforces 1491H. Yuezheng Ling and Dynamic Tree 题解

题目链接:H. Yuezheng Ling and Dynamic Tree 题目大意:给定一棵大小为 n 的一 为根节点的树,树用如下方式给出:输入 a ,a , dots,a n ,保证 leq a i lt i ,将 a i 与 i 连边形成一棵树。 接下来有两种操作: l r x 令 a i max a i x, l leq i leq r 。 u v 查询在当前的 a 数组构成的树上 u ...

2021-03-01 10:12 4 158 推荐指数:

查看详情

Codeforces Gym 102392F Game on a Tree (SEERC2019 F题) 题解

题目链接:https://codeforces.com/gym/102392/problem/F 题意:被这题题意坑了很久,大意是说有一棵根为 \(1\) 的树,每个节点初始都是白色, \(Alice\) 能在这棵树的某个节点放下一个棋子,并使得该节点变为黑色,然后从 \(Bob\) 开始,两人 ...

Mon Nov 04 06:31:00 CST 2019 0 340
Codeforces Round #569 题解

Codeforces Round #569 题解 CF1179A Valeriy and Deque 有一个双端队列,每次取队首两个值,将较小值移动到队尾,较大值位置不变。多组询问求第\(m\)次操作时队首两个数。 显然\(O(n)\)次以内队首变成了最大值,之后就循环了,暴力前 ...

Sun Jun 23 07:03:00 CST 2019 2 374
codeforces 1295 题解(完结)

codeforces 1295 题解 A. Display The Number 给你可显示的总数,让你凑个最大的数,很明显,抽象的思想就是“好钢要用在刀刃上”,如果可显示的数字越大,所消耗的越小,他自然更好。 我们观察一下各个数字的消耗情况: 0 1 2 3 4 5 6 7 8 9 ...

Thu Jan 30 18:39:00 CST 2020 0 225
Codeforces Round #556 题解

Codeforces Round #556 题解 Div.2 A Stock Arbitraging 傻逼题 Div.2 B Tiling Challenge 傻逼题 Div.1 A Prefix Sum Primes 傻逼题,先放2,1然后放完2然后放完1 Div.1 B ...

Wed May 01 06:08:00 CST 2019 0 627
Codeforces Round #732 题解

AquaMoon and Two Arrays 因为要求每一次操作后数都要大于 \(0\), 于是我们每一次选一个大于其目标值的数把它减一,选一个小于其目标值的数把它加一即可。 AquaMoon ...

Tue Jul 13 01:39:00 CST 2021 0 916
Codeforces Round #557 题解【更完了】

Codeforces Round #557 题解 掉分快乐 CF1161A Hide and Seek Alice和Bob在玩捉♂迷♂藏,有\(n\)个格子,Bob会检查\(k\)次,第\(i\)次检查第\(x_i\)个格子,如果Alice在这个格子就输了。Alice一开始会在一个格子 ...

Sun May 05 19:21:00 CST 2019 2 547
Codeforces Global Round 15 题解

A - Subsequence Permutation 求出 \(s\) 排序后的结果 \(t\),计算 \(s, t\) 不同的位置数即可。 B - Running for Gold 答案唯一 ...

Tue Jul 27 22:40:00 CST 2021 0 197
Codeforces 1474F. 1 2 3 4 ... 题解

题目大意:给定一个序列,求其中最长严格上升子序列长度及其个数。 序列按如下方式给出:给定 \(n(1\leq n\leq 50)\) 和序列中的第一个数 \(x(-10^9\leq x\leq 10 ...

Fri Jan 22 00:59:00 CST 2021 2 337
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M